Key Players and Their Trade Value

Now, let's get down to brass tacks, guys. When we're dissecting Brooklyn Nets trade news today, certain names inevitably pop up. The trade value of a player isn't just about their stats on paper; it's a complex calculation involving their contract, age, potential, and how well they fit into a new system. For the Nets, players like Mikal Bridges, Cam Johnson, and Nic Claxton often feature in these discussions. Bridges, in particular, has emerged as a bona fide star, averaging significant points and showing impressive defensive prowess. His value is sky-high, making him a cornerstone piece that would command a substantial return. However, whether the Nets are even willing to consider moving him is the million-dollar question. Cam Johnson, with his versatile scoring and shooting ability, also holds considerable appeal for many teams looking to add offensive firepower. His contract situation will undoubtedly be a factor in how teams value him. Then there's Nic Claxton, an elite rim protector and a strong finisher around the basket. His defensive impact is undeniable, and in today's NBA, that's a premium skill. Teams that struggle defensively or need a dominant big man would surely inquire. But, like Bridges, his importance to the Nets' core identity is significant. Beyond these prominent figures, other players on the roster could be moved for depth, draft picks, or to clear salary cap space. Veteran players might be packaged in deals to match salaries, or younger, less-established players could be sent out to gain experience elsewhere. The Nets' front office has to weigh the immediate impact of losing a player against the potential gains from acquiring new assets. It's a delicate balancing act. Remember, trade value fluctuates. A strong performance streak can boost a player’s stock, while injuries or slumps can diminish it. Keep an eye on how these key players are performing – it directly impacts their leverage in any potential trade talks. Ultimately, understanding the perceived value of each player is key to deciphering the Brooklyn Nets trade news today and anticipating their next move.

Analyzing Recent Trade Rumors

Yo, let's get into the nitty-gritty of the actual Brooklyn Nets trade news today. Rumors fly fast and furious in the NBA, and it’s our job to sift through the noise and identify what’s credible. Sometimes, a rumor might stem from a report by a reputable journalist, linking a specific player to the Nets for a particular reason. Other times, it’s more speculative, based on team needs or general league chatter. We’ve seen reports connecting the Nets to various players across the league. Perhaps there’s talk of them pursuing a star player from a team that’s struggling, or maybe they’re looking to acquire role players who can address specific weaknesses. It’s important to remember that not all rumors materialize into trades. Many are just smoke screens, leverage plays by agents, or simply the media trying to create buzz. However, some rumors do have legs. We need to evaluate the source. Is it a well-connected insider like Adrian Wojnarowski or Shams Charania, or is it a more obscure source? The context of the rumor is also key. Does it align with the Nets' stated goals or their known needs? For instance, if the Nets are publicly emphasizing their need for a rim protector, and a rumor links them to a highly-rated defensive big man, that’s more likely to be worth paying attention to. We also have to consider the financial implications. Can the Nets absorb the salary of the player being rumored? Do they have the draft picks or young assets to make a deal happen? It’s a complex web of factors. Sometimes, rumors can even influence team strategies. If a team knows another team is desperately looking to move a player, they might hold out for a better offer. Conversely, if a team knows they need a certain type of player, and rumors suggest another team has one available, they might become more aggressive in their pursuit. So, when you hear about the latest Brooklyn Nets trade news today, take it with a grain of salt, but also analyze the underlying reasons and the potential validity based on the sources and the team's situation.
